Senior Product Manager, AI/ML Platform Products

We are seeking an experienced Senior Product Manager to lead the strategy and delivery of AI/ML platform products – the core platform that powers AI/ML model training and deployment across GSK R&D. This role is central to establishing a unified, scalable, and governed enterprise approach to AI/ML, ensuring that R&D teams can efficiently build, evaluate, and operationalize models and ultimately deliver new medicines for our patients.

Key responsibilities:

  • Ownership & Strategy
    Own and drive the product vision, roadmap, and adoption of the AI/ML Platform, delivering core capabilities for model training, fine‑tuning, evaluation, deployment, monitoring, and lifecycle management.
  • Customer & Stakeholder Engagement
    Conduct ongoing customer discovery with scientists and AI/ML practitioners to identify emerging needs and translate them into actionable product requirements; lead technical product discussions with engineering and scientific leaders to clarify objectives and shape platform direction.
  • Product Planning & Delivery
    Collaborate with stakeholders to define platform features, requirements, and success criteria aligned with scientific use cases and business goals; drive agile product execution with engineering and program teams, owning prioritization, backlog management, and delivery of high‑quality platform releases.
  • Platform Integration & Governance
    Ensure seamless integration with the Data Platform to enable shared data standards and consistent data/model lifecycle management; coordinate and align product roadmap with R&D platforms to ensure interoperability, governance alignment, and a unified enterprise data, compute, AI, and application ecosystem.
  • Launch, Adoption & Optimization
    Lead platform launches and change‑management activities to ensure clear communication, training, and successful adoption across R&D; monitor platform usage and performance, analyze feedback and telemetry, and drive continuous improvements to enhance usability, reliability, and scientific impact.
